The Calderón problem for the infinity Laplacian with large affine boundary data

arXiv:2608.17797

Abstract

We study the Calderón problem for the equation in a bounded convex domain with boundary. We prove that a positive potential is uniquely determined and explicitly reconstructible from the measurements , where , the offset is fixed, and . The first potential-dependent term in the large amplitude asymptotics determines weighted integrals of over the chords parallel to . Combining the measurements in the directions and gives the X-ray transform of the zero extension of , and the Fourier slice identity yields reconstruction and uniqueness.
